以太坊,作為全球第二大區(qū)塊鏈平臺(tái),憑借其智能合約功能和龐大的生態(tài)系統(tǒng),成為了去中心化金融(DeFi)、非同質(zhì)化代幣(NFT)和去中心化應(yīng)用(dApp)的溫床,隨著用戶數(shù)量的激增和應(yīng)用場(chǎng)景的日益復(fù)雜化,以太坊主網(wǎng)面臨著一個(gè)日益嚴(yán)峻的挑戰(zhàn)——可擴(kuò)展性不足,高昂的交易費(fèi)用和較慢的交易確認(rèn)速度,常常讓普通用戶望而卻步,也制約了以太坊生態(tài)的進(jìn)一步發(fā)展,為了破解這一難題,“二層以太坊擴(kuò)展”(Ethereum Layer 2 Scaling)技術(shù)應(yīng)運(yùn)而生,并被廣泛認(rèn)為是以太坊實(shí)現(xiàn)大規(guī)模采納的關(guān)鍵所在。

以太坊的可擴(kuò)展性困境:為何需要二層?

要理解二層擴(kuò)展的重要性,首先需要明白以太坊主網(wǎng)(一層,Layer 1)面臨的瓶頸,以太坊主網(wǎng)采用的是工作量證明(PoW,正逐步轉(zhuǎn)向權(quán)益證明PoS)共識(shí)機(jī)制,每秒只能處理有限數(shù)量的交易(TPS,目前PoS下約15-30 TPS),當(dāng)網(wǎng)絡(luò)擁堵時(shí),交易費(fèi)用(Gas費(fèi))會(huì)飆升,交易確認(rèn)時(shí)間也會(huì)大大延長(zhǎng),這就像一條只有少數(shù)車道的高速公路,車流量一大,便會(huì)嚴(yán)重堵塞。

Layer 1的擴(kuò)容方案,如增加區(qū)塊大小或縮短出塊時(shí)間,往往面臨著去中心化、安全性和可擴(kuò)展性三者難以兼得的“區(qū)塊鏈不可能三角”,單純的擴(kuò)容可能會(huì)削弱以太坊的去中心化特性,增加節(jié)點(diǎn)的負(fù)擔(dān),甚至帶來(lái)安全風(fēng)險(xiǎn),將部分交易負(fù)擔(dān)從主網(wǎng)轉(zhuǎn)移出去,成為更優(yōu)的解決方案,這便是二層擴(kuò)展的核心思路。

什么是二層以太坊擴(kuò)展(Layer 2)?

二層擴(kuò)展(Layer 2)是指在以太坊主網(wǎng)(Layer 1)之上構(gòu)建的附加協(xié)議或網(wǎng)絡(luò),它們通過(guò)將大量的計(jì)算和交易處理移至 Layer 2 進(jìn)行,只將最終結(jié)果或必要的證明數(shù)據(jù)返回到 Layer 1 進(jìn)行結(jié)算和確認(rèn),這種方式類似于在一條主干高速公路(Layer 1)旁邊修建了許多輔助道路和停車場(chǎng)(Layer 2),車輛可以在這些輔助道路快速通行,最終再匯入主干道,從而大大提高了整體的交通效率。

Layer 2 的目標(biāo)是實(shí)現(xiàn):

  1. 更高的交易速度(TPS):Layer 2 可以處理遠(yuǎn)超主網(wǎng)的交易數(shù)量。
  2. 更低的交易費(fèi)用:由于大部分計(jì)算在 Layer 2 完成,用戶支付給 Layer 1 的 Gas 費(fèi)用大幅降低。
  3. 保持安全性:Layer 2 仍然依賴于以太坊主網(wǎng)的安全保障,其最終結(jié)算由主網(wǎng)確認(rèn)。
  4. 去中心化:Layer 2 方案通常致力于保持甚至增強(qiáng)以太坊的去中心化特性。

主流二層擴(kuò)展技術(shù)類型

二層擴(kuò)展技術(shù)主要分為以下幾類:

  1. 狀態(tài)通道(State Channels)

    • 原理:參與方在鏈下進(jìn)行多次交易,只在開(kāi)啟和關(guān)閉通道時(shí)與主網(wǎng)交互,通道內(nèi)的交易即時(shí)、低成本。
    • 特點(diǎn):適用于多參與方、高頻次的交互場(chǎng)景,如游戲、微支付。
    • 例子:Lightning Network(主要用于比特幣,但原理類似)、Connext、Raiden。
    • 局限:需要預(yù)先鎖定資金,且通道外無(wú)法驗(yàn)證交易狀態(tài)。
  2. 側(cè)鏈(Sidechains)

    • 原理:與以太坊主網(wǎng)并行運(yùn)行的獨(dú)立區(qū)塊鏈,擁有自己的共識(shí)機(jī)制,通過(guò)雙向錨定(Two-way Peg)實(shí)現(xiàn)資產(chǎn)在主網(wǎng)和側(cè)鏈之間的轉(zhuǎn)移。
    • 特點(diǎn):獨(dú)立性高,可以定制共識(shí)機(jī)制以實(shí)現(xiàn)特定性能目標(biāo)。
    • 例子:POA Network、xDai Chain(現(xiàn)稱Gnosis Chain)。
    • 局限:安全性相對(duì)獨(dú)立于主網(wǎng),需要自己維護(hù)節(jié)點(diǎn),安全性通常弱于主網(wǎng)。
  3. Rollups(匯總)

    • 原理:這是目前最受關(guān)注且最具潛力的 Layer 2 方案,Rollups 將大量交易數(shù)據(jù)“匯總”后,作為一個(gè)批次計(jì)算處理,并將計(jì)算結(jié)果和數(shù)據(jù)的證明提交到以太坊主網(wǎng),主網(wǎng)負(fù)責(zé)驗(yàn)證這些證明的正確性。
    • 優(yōu)勢(shì):既保留了以太坊主網(wǎng)的安全性,又能顯著提升性能和降低成本。
    • 主要子類
      • Optimistic Rollups(樂(lè)觀匯總):假設(shè)提交的交易批次是有效的,除非有人提出欺詐證明,如果一段時(shí)間內(nèi)無(wú)人挑戰(zhàn),則交易被最終確認(rèn),優(yōu)點(diǎn)是實(shí)現(xiàn)相對(duì)簡(jiǎn)單,成本更低。
        • 例子:Arbitrum、Optimism、zkSync(早期版本)。
      • ZK-Rollups(零知識(shí)匯總):使用零知識(shí)密碼學(xué)(如ZK-SNARKs或ZK-STARKs)生成一個(gè)證明,該證明可以驗(yàn)證交易批次的正確性,而無(wú)需暴露交易細(xì)節(jié)本身,安全性更高,結(jié)算更快,但技術(shù)實(shí)現(xiàn)更復(fù)雜,證明生成和驗(yàn)證成本較高。
        • 例子:StarkWare(StarkNet)、zkSync、Loopring、Scroll。

二層擴(kuò)展的挑戰(zhàn)與未來(lái)展望

盡管 Layer 2 展現(xiàn)出巨大的潛力,但仍面臨一些挑戰(zhàn):

  • 用戶體驗(yàn):錢包支持、跨鏈交互的便捷性仍需改進(jìn)。
  • 互操作性:不同 Layer 2 之間的資產(chǎn)和通信如何高效流轉(zhuǎn)。
  • 安全性:特別是對(duì)于 Optimistic Rollups 的欺詐證明機(jī)制和 ZK-Rollups 的零知識(shí)證明安全性,需要持續(xù)審計(jì)和驗(yàn)證。
  • 治理與標(biāo)準(zhǔn)化:Layer 2 生態(tài)的治理結(jié)構(gòu)和與以太坊主網(wǎng)的協(xié)同治理需要探索。

展望未來(lái),二層以太坊擴(kuò)展無(wú)疑是以太坊生態(tài)發(fā)展的重中之重,隨著以太坊本身通過(guò)“合并”(The Merge)、“合并后升級(jí)”(如Sharding,分片技術(shù),雖不直接是Layer 2,但與Layer 2協(xié)同工作)等不斷提升基礎(chǔ)性能,Layer 2 將作為重要的補(bǔ)充,共同構(gòu)建一個(gè)高吞吐量、低成本、安全且去中心化的區(qū)塊鏈網(wǎng)絡(luò)。

各大項(xiàng)目團(tuán)隊(duì)正在積極優(yōu)化技術(shù)、降低成本、提升用戶體驗(yàn),我們有理由相信,在不久的將來(lái),Layer 2 將承載起以太坊生態(tài)的大部分交易和應(yīng)用,讓以太坊真正從“世界計(jì)算機(jī)”的夢(mèng)

隨機(jī)配圖
想走向大規(guī)?,F(xiàn)實(shí),為全球用戶帶來(lái)更高效、更普惠的區(qū)塊鏈服務(wù),對(duì)于開(kāi)發(fā)者和用戶而言,關(guān)注和理解 Layer 2 的發(fā)展,將意味著抓住下一波區(qū)塊鏈創(chuàng)新浪潮的機(jī)遇。